Bicyclist injured after being struck by semi-truck in Tennessee

TENNESSEE — A bicyclist was critically injured Tuesday morning after being struck by a semi-truck in Alcoa, authorities reported.

Alcoa police responded to the crash around 8 a.m. at the intersection of East Hunt Road and North Wright Road. Officials said the truck and the cyclist were traveling in the same direction when the collision occurred.

First responders, including police, fire, and AMR personnel, administered CPR at the scene. The cyclist was transported to the University of Tennessee Medical Center in critical condition.

Police remain on the scene investigating, and drivers are advised to avoid the area.
